Red Bone Marrow

A type of marrow found in certain bones that is responsible for the production of blood cells, including red blood cells, white blood cells, and platelets.

Blood Cell Formation

The process, also known as hematopoiesis, by which new blood cells are produced, primarily taking place in the bone marrow from stem cells.

Tendon

Strap of dense connective tissue that connects a skeletal muscle to bone.

Ligament

Strap of dense connective tissue that holds bones together at a joint.
